His college numbers just scream Boobie Gibson/Tyron Lue to me. Just compared to the other college pgs who went 1st round-2nd worst at getting to the FT line,near the bottom of the pack in assists(so was teague though),the worst rebounder,and shot the lowest percentage by a wide margin. All of these while playing in a mid major conference.
Now I wouldn't have been mad if we had taken him at 49,but I just don't think he's good enough at any one particular aspect to even consider at 19.

^^^ Well put. All 4 guys mentioned would require either all or at least a big chunk of the MLE. That makes them exclusive of one another. You can break up the MLE, but the sum of the parts can't exceed the MLE itself. You can get one of them then it means using BAE and minimums on free agents that we don't have the rights to. Chris Wilcox is the only guy I think may fall substantially lower. If market proves tough he might be had for the BAE, but that would be a late signing (it would take time for him to realize the reality of the situation).
